Common problem for new Amazon sellers. They apply the inventory barcode to the bulk packaging and not the actual products. In this case, they should have made 4 printout barcodes for Amazon warehouse workers to shelve instead of the one. Same thing happened to me with a mousepad a while ago. Got 8 mousepads.
